Q: Is 822,207,687 a Composite Number?

 A: Yes, 822,207,687 is a composite number.

Why is 822,207,687 a composite number?

A composite number is a number that can be divided evenly by more numbers than 1 and itself. It is the opposite of a prime number.

The number 822,207,687 can be evenly divided by 1 3 7 21 43 73 129 219 301 511 903 1,533 3,139 9,417 12,473 21,973 37,419 65,919 87,311 261,933 536,339 910,529 1,609,017 2,731,587 3,754,373 6,373,703 11,263,119 19,121,109 39,152,747 117,458,241 274,069,229 and 822,207,687, with no remainder.

Since 822,207,687 cannot be divided by just 1 and 822,207,687, it is a composite number.
